While flounder and game fish that relate close to the bottom blend in with the substrate below, certain species that swim in open water environments are known to have the ability to manipulate light in an effort to better blend with their surroundings. Scientist have already discovered that numerous species of marine inhabitants are sensitive to polarization light levels and have the ability to see structure in lightsomething humans cannot. To replace a record fish weighing 25 pounds (11.33 kg) or more, the replacement must weigh at least one half of 1 percent (0.5%) more than the existing record. Description: Lookdown fish have laterally flat, reflective bodies with a steep forehead and protruding lower jaw.
